Police seized a truck carrying 2000 pieces of raw cow leather in Ujjain.

The Madhya Pradesh crime branch and the Mahakal police together arrested three people with a trolley full of skins of two thousand cows from Ratadiya.

The Madhya Pradesh crime branch and the Mahakal police together arrested three people with a trolley full of skins of two thousand cows from Ratadiya.A trolley near Mohanpura on Badnagar Road was caught with 500 bundles, with each bundle containing four pieces of cow skins. The incident occurred on July 17, 2018. During the interrogation, the accused (namely Narendra Kumar Putra Ramchandra Prajapat, Umesh Putra Rambhajan Prajapat, and Ravi Putra Kanhaiyalal) admitted that the skins were collected from a warehouse in Ratadiya village, Ujjain, and taken to Kolkata. According to ASP Pramod Sonkar, who spoke to Free Press Journal, the total net worth of the confiscated skins was around ₹8 lakh and purportedly taken to make shoes. Further Superindent of Police, IPS Sachin Atulkar ordered the file case on all three accused under National Security Act (NSA).
